Bomber strikes Baghdad police station, killing at least 20
BAGHDAD A suicide car bomber driving a truck loaded with explosives slammed into a Baghdad police station Sunday, killing at least 20 people and wounding another 30, police said.
The attacker detonated his deadly charge at the Rashad police station in the eastern neighborhood of Mashtal around 2:50 p.m., said Capt. Mahir Abdul Satar. The vehicle crashed into concrete barriers surrounding the police station.
Six cars, including two police cars, were seen burning and several nearby shops were damaged, police officials said. Body parts lay scattered throughout the explosion area.
